

Hours after U.S. secretary of state arrived in Pakistan this morning, a car bomb ignited in a crowded market area. So far 91 people are dead, and more that 200 injured.
The Taliban admitted responsibility to these attacks.
They said that they targeted the UN because of the elections scheduled to take place on November 7, and warned that there are more attacks to come.
